I attached an unindexed record to my tree, which I found through Records search.

When I view the record from the profile to which it was attached (the lone source in this profile, Ong Ping Con, P479-MZ1), when I click on "Web Page (Link to the Record" or "View the original document," This message gets thrown: "Cannot Display Image Group"

Fortunately, I found a trivial workaround: appending "www" to the URL makes the image viewable. Opening the record from my source box also works.

I tried to edit the Web Page (Link to the Record) on the record itself to include the www but the URL is grayed out and cannot be edited.

Is there a way to amend the record so that it can be viewable from the profile (i.e., I don't need to view it from the source box)?
